Blood type calculator punnett square - The Human ABO markers: The A, B, and O alleles. Human blood type is determined by co-dominant alleles. An allele is one of several different forms of genetic information that is present in our DNA at a specific location on a specific chromosome. There are three different alleles for human blood type, known as I A, I B, and i.

Blood type (or blood group) is a genetic characteristic associated with the presence or absence of certain molecules, called antigens, on the surface of red blood cells. These molecules may help maintain the integrity of the cell membrane, act as receptors, or have other biological functions. If you have A antigens covering your red cells, then you have blood group A and you also have B-antibodies. If you have B antigens covering your red cells, then you have blood group B and you also have A antibodies. In order to have AB type blood, offspring must be AB because ofThe Genetics of ABO Blood Type. The ABO system is under the control of a gene found on chromosome 9. Three alleles can be found on the locus for the blood type gene. The A allele codes for the A glycoprotein. The B allele codes for the B glycoprotein. Rh...For example, if someone with type A blood is given type B blood, then anti-B antibodies from type A blood will attack type B cells. That is why a person with type A blood should never be given a type B blood, and vice versa. Trihybrid cross calculator allows you to create a Punnett square for 3 different qualities easily. A two-trait Punnett Square has 16 boxes. The probability of a cross producing a genotype in any box is 1 in 16. If the same genotype is present in two boxes, its probability of occurring doubles to 1/8 (1/16 + 1/16).
